• ベストアンサー

再アップしたら写真が表示されなくなった

HPをUPして、その後その一ページのテキストを修正して再度UPしたのですが、写真が表示されなくなりました。その写真のプロパティーを見ると file:///D:/Documents%20and%20Settings/NEOSOFT/デスクトップ/奥様ジャーナル/当号奥様ジャーナル/htdocs/simen050304/tour4gatu05/oumi03.jpg のように自分のPCにリンクされてしまっていました。 が正しい表示だと思うのですが、なぜこのようになってしまったのでしょうか?教えてください。よろしくお願いします。

質問者が選んだベストアンサー

  • ベストアンサー
  • gura_
  • ベストアンサー率44% (749/1683)
回答No.5

 #1です。追加です。  何らかの理由で、<base>タグが入っている場合は、そのタグを消すか、適正なアドレスにしてみてください。  参考サイト↓ http://www-6.ibm.com/jp/domino01/swhc/esupport.nsf/all/hpb0124  <base>タグの意味や使い方はこちら↓ http://www.tohoho-web.com/html/base.htm

neosoft
質問者

お礼

皆様 回答ありがとうございます。 guraさんの言うようにファイルの文頭の4行目ぐらいに、何らかの理由で、<base>タグが入っていました。 なぜ、このタグが入ったかはわかりませんが、この行を削除して保存し直し、UPをやり直したらみごと直りました。 大変ありがとうございました。いい勉強になりました。

その他の回答 (4)

  • gura_
  • ベストアンサー率44% (749/1683)
回答No.4

 #1です。  繰り返しますが、サイトでなくページ(tour.htmなど)を「一旦ビルダーで開いてからそのページを保存して下さい」  ファイルを保存すると、ビルダーでは自動的に相対アドレスにするようになっています。  上の作業をすれば、ご自分PC上で、tour.htm の中身が相対アドレスのタグに直っているはずです。・・・「HTMLソース」で確認できます。  直っていないなら何度アップロードしても問題は解決しません。  保存しても直らない場合は、下記ページを参考にして下さい。 http://hpb.cool.ne.jp/hpbuilder/hp_hozon.htm  念のためその図(http://hpb.cool.ne.jp/hpbuilder/image417.gif)ののように「保存場所へファイルをコピーする」のチェックがしてあるのも確認してください。  タグがお分かりなら「HTMLソース」を直接直すことも可能です。参考↓ http://www.tohoho-web.com/wwwbeg5.htm#RelativeLink  蛇足!! 「曰く 生兵法は怪我の素」  落ち着いて、ビルダーの「ホームページを作成する前に」「サイトとは」等を改めてご覧になることをお勧めします。  また、ビルダーを使ってもホームページの基本事項は勉強されておく必要があります。↓ http://www.tohoho-web.com/wwwbeg.htm

回答No.3

> index.htmの下にtour.htmはあります。 それは、この件とは関係なくて、 tour.htmと同じ階層に、oumi03.jpgがあるようにしないといけないと思います。 >「ファイルのコピー」欄が「する」の状態になっていることを確認し ここで、もう一度画像をページと同じ階層に保存するようにしてみてはいかがでしょう。

  • gura_
  • ベストアンサー率44% (749/1683)
回答No.2

#1です こちらのほうが解かりやすいかもしれません。↓ http://www-6.ibm.com/jp/domino01/swhc/esupport.nsf/all/hpb0457

参考URL:
http://www-6.ibm.com/jp/domino01/swhc/esupport.nsf/all/hpb0457
neosoft
質問者

補足

早速に回答をいただきありがとうございました。 確かに絶対パスになっていることを確認しました。 参考URLを読んでみましたのですが絶対パスを相対パスにする方法がよくわかりません。 IBMの回答に…… 編集中のページを保存すると、「素材ファイルをコピーして保存」ダイアログが表示されます。該当する画像ファイルの「ファイルのコピー」欄が「する」の状態になっていることを確認し…… とありますがデフォルトでは「する」になっていますし、一時は正確に表示されていていましたが、そのページのテキストを直してUPしてからこういう現象が起きました。 ----------------------- 絶対パスから相対パスへの変更方法は以下の通りです。 1ページを保存していない場合は、保存してください。 2サイトを開いた状態でフォルダ外に保存している場合は、サイトフォルダ内に保存しなおすか、サイトを閉じた状態でページを保存しなおしてください。 ------------------------ 上記の2がわかりません。サイト(S)→サイトを開く(O)でサイトを開いたのですがindex.htmの下にtour.htmはあります。 何度も該当ページを保存してはUPしていますが直りません。やっていることが違うのでしょうか?

  • gura_
  • ベストアンサー率44% (749/1683)
回答No.1

 一旦ビルダーでtour.htmを保存しないために起こったのではないでしょうか。  一旦保存すると、画像のURLが相対アドレスになって、おっしゃっている正しい表示になるはずです。  あまり参考にはならないかもしれませんが下記サイトなどをご参考に http://www-6.ibm.com/jp/domino01/swhc/esupport.nsf/all/hpb1106 http://www-6.ibm.com/jp/domino01/swhc/esupport.nsf/all/hpb0124  なお このページは削除される可能性があります

参考URL:
http://www-6.ibm.com/jp/domino01/swhc/esupport.nsf/all/hpb1106
neosoft
質問者

お礼

ありがとうございました

関連するQ&A